AI-first platform for building commerce stores, fast
Your Next Store (YNS) is an innovative AI-first platform designed for rapid creation of commerce stores, targeting agencies, developers, and brands seeking a design-forward, customizable e-commerce solution. By leveraging AI-driven chat interfaces, users can effortlessly build their stores, while the underlying architecture is built on a well-structured, Stripe-native Next.js application. This setup ensures production-ready performance, full code ownership, and seamless integration with AI workflows like Codex and Claude Code, making it ideal for those who want both flexibility and automation in their commerce operations. The platformβs focus on opinionated, well-modeled commerce primitives simplifies complex tasks and accelerates deployment, positioning itself as a future-proof solution for agentic commerce building where intelligent agents can reason, build, and operate stores efficiently.
